

Spider Web Phone Case
A phone case featuring an open-back spider web pattern that doubles as a bold visual statement and a lightweight structural shell. The design explores how much material can be removed while still maintaining protective coverage and rigidity at key impact points.
Design Details
The web pattern radiates from a central point on the back panel, with thicker strands along the edges and corners where impact protection matters most. The open cutouts reduce weight and give the case a distinctive skeletal look. The raised lip around the screen edge and camera cutout are maintained for drop protection. Available in multiple colorways, rendered here in red, black, and blue.
Key Considerations
- Structural integrity maintained through strategic strand thickness and corner reinforcement
- Lightweight feel without sacrificing edge and corner protection
- Eye-catching aesthetic that stands out from typical solid-shell cases
- Designed for 3D printing or injection molding production
